In honor of Venom's 30th anniversary, your favorite Super Heroes and Villains are being Venomized, and it's safe to say the universe will never be the same.
Venom's first victim, journalist Eddie Brock, is a natural choice for the Funko Pop! Marvel Venom Series. Similarly, Cletus Kasady and Carnage, despite being considered an "I" rather than a "we," are another natural choice for the Venom series.
While it's difficult to picture the Hulk any color but green, he makes Venom's signature black costume work for him. Captain America manages to retain his usual red, white and blue color scheme even as Venom. And Iron Man's determined to fly, even as Venom's captive.
Pop! figures bring your favorite Marvel characters to life with a unique stylized design. Each vinyl figure stands 3.75 inches tall and comes in window box packaging, making them great for display!

Founded by Martin Goodman and later launched as Marvel in 1961, Marvel has become an iconic comic book publisher that has expanded to other media like films and video games with a great amount of success. Marvel is home to iconic superheroes like Spider-man, Iron Man, Hulk, Captain America, and many more. Marvel has seen another level of success and popularization with the launch of the brand's Marvel cinematic universe beginning in the late 2000's.
